libftdi-git Archives

Subject: port libftdi to libusb-1.0 branch, master, updated. v0.17-216-g71ac874

From: libftdi-git@xxxxxxxxxxxxxxxxxxxxxxx
To: libftdi-git@xxxxxxxxxxxxxxxxxxxxxxx
Date: Tue, 28 Jun 2011 16:38:15 +0200 (CEST)
The branch, master has been updated
       via  71ac8745e5d05fe9863a6281c6dd1cb7ece3e74a (commit)
      from  ae6585f123e199bf57cff9074e46211e16f57cd4 (commit)


- Log -----------------------------------------------------------------
commit 71ac8745e5d05fe9863a6281c6dd1cb7ece3e74a
Author: Uwe Bonnes <bon@x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x>
Date:   Tue Jun 21 16:14:48 2011 +0200

    1.0/src/ftdi_stream.c: Check for fitting device

-----------------------------------------------------------------------

Summary of changes:
 src/ftdi_stream.c |    7 +++++++
 1 files changed, 7 insertions(+), 0 deletions(-)

diff --git a/src/ftdi_stream.c b/src/ftdi_stream.c
index 6b5b61c..b949999 100644
--- a/src/ftdi_stream.c
+++ b/src/ftdi_stream.c
@@ -152,6 +152,13 @@ ftdi_readstream(struct ftdi_context *ftdi,
     int bufferSize = packetsPerTransfer * ftdi->max_packet_size;
     int xferIndex;
     int err = 0;
+
+    /* Only FT2232H and FT232H know about the synchronous FIFO Mode*/
+    if ((ftdi->type != TYPE_2232H) && (ftdi->type != TYPE_232H))
+    {
+        fprintf(stderr,"Device doesn't support synchronous FIFO mode\n");
+        return 1;
+    }
     
     /* We don't know in what state we are, switch to reset*/
     if (ftdi_set_bitmode(ftdi,  0xff, BITMODE_RESET) < 0)


hooks/post-receive
-- 
port libftdi to libusb-1.0

--
libftdi-git - see http://www.intra2net.com/en/developer/libftdi for details.
To unsubscribe send a mail to libftdi-git+unsubscribe@xxxxxxxxxxxxxxxxxxxxxxx   

Current Thread
  • port libftdi to libusb-1.0 branch, master, updated. v0.17-216-g71ac874, libftdi-git <=